Ericsson offers anti virus for operators

Ericsson is offering the industry's first mobile antivirus solution specifically designed for operator environments.Ericsson Mobile Device Antivirus is now available as part of Ericsson's Mobile Data Solutions portfolio, which offers enterprises secure mobile access to business-critical data applications.

Ericsson and NRK launch world's first interactive mobile TV

Ericsson and the Norwegian Broadcasting Corporation (NRK) conduct the world's first live trial of interactive mobile TV.
